Gene ID | LotjaGi6g1v0219100 |
Transcript ID | LotjaGi6g1v0219100.1 |
Lotus japonicus genome version | Gifu v1.2 |
Description | Pectinesterase; TAIR: AT3G43270.1 Plant invertase/pectin methylesterase inhibitor superfamily; Swiss-Prot: sp|Q9LXK7|PME32_ARATH Probable pectinesterase/pectinesterase inhibitor 32; TrEMBL-Plants: tr|A0A0B2SEU6|A0A0B2SEU6_GLYSO Pectinesterase; Found in the gene: LotjaGi6g1v0219100 |
Working Lj name | n.a. |

GO predictions are based solely on the InterPro-to-GO mappings published by EMBL-EBI, which are in turn based on the mapping of predicted domains to the InterPro dataset. The InterPro-to-GO mapping was last updated on , while the GO metadata was last updated on .
GO term | Namespace | Name | Definition | Relationships |
---|---|---|---|---|
Molecular function | Enzyme inhibitor activity | Binds to and stops, prevents or reduces the activity of an enzyme. | ||
Molecular function | Pectinesterase activity | Catalysis of the reaction: pectin + n H2O = n methanol + pectate. | ||
Biological process | Cell wall modification | The series of events leading to chemical and structural alterations of an existing cell wall that can result in loosening, increased extensibility or disassembly. |
